				<dd2:Name><![CDATA[Aggregated Data on Nitrate]]></dd2:Name>
				<dd2:Definition><![CDATA[Data on Nitrate in groundwater bodies, including information on the number and type of sampling sites, the monitoring frequency, the number of sampling sites for each range of concentration values and statistics, are requested from EEA Member Countries on an annual basis.]]></dd2:Definition>
				<dd3:Methodology><![CDATA[Many EEA Member Countries have previously submitted data on Nitrate in groundwater. The chemical quality data, the physical characteristics of, and proxy pressures on the groundwater bodies, up to the last year of requested data, are available to be viewed and downloaded from the publicly accessible Waterbase, hosted by the EEA Data Service at: http://dataservice.eea.europa.eu/dataservice/metadetails.asp?id=832.

Data providers are asked to check and validate their published data, and include any amendments in their next delivery of data.

Data on Nitrate are requested as disaggregated data but can be provided as annually aggregated values, if preferred. On aggregation, sample concentration values recorded as below the limit of detection or quantification should be replaced with a value equivalent to half the limit of detection or quantification.

The following fields combine to create a unique record: EWN-Code, Year and Value. No duplicate records should exist within this combination.

We would like to encourage all countries to provide data on Nitrate in groundwater, for as long a time series as possible.]]></dd3:Methodology>
